RAINWATER HARVESTING & UTILISATION PROGRAMME AS-REWA Rainwater management is supported by the Czech legislation. While building their family houses, people are required by the building control authorities to provide for the rainwater liquidation on their construction sites. In any case, the rainwater management is an issue that should be treated not only comprehensively, but already in the preparation phase of design documents for the building warrant procedures. We can offer to you the most suitable solutions how to use and manage rainwater falling to the relevant building site. Such precipitations can be accumulated and consequently used in households, where they can replace, without any problems, drinking water for WC flushing, washing, etc. The rainwater is accumulated in underground tanks with subsequent overflows to stormwater infiltration facilities that replenish underground water reserves. The most simple, widely used and well known to everybody is the system of bringing rainwater from a roof gutter to a drum in a garden and its consequent utilisation for irrigation purposes. In principle, the AS-REWA system for the household use is practically the same philosophy, but its design and technical level is at a substantially higher and modern levels. AS-RAINMASTEROPTIMISED EQUIPMENT FOR RAINWATER UTILISATION IN FAMILY HOUSES AS-RAINMASTER is a fully automated operating and monitoring unit with a pump, control system and integrated replenishment with drinking water.. The equipment can be installed in a cellar, garage, or a groundfloor plantroom of any family house. Over the suction pipe, the water is sucked from the reservoir and then it is brought for garden irrigation purposes, flushing of toilets and filling of washing machines.
